How is war shown in tomorrow when the war began?

As the title suggests, war is central in John Marsden’s Tomorrow, When the War Began. After a group of Australian teenagers return from a camping trip in the bush to find their small town invaded and taken over by an unknown foreign power, they fear it is the beginning of World War Three.

Who attacked Australia in Tomorrow, When the War Began?

Coalition Nations
The group hears a radio transmission revealing that Australia has been invaded by Asian “Coalition Nations”, who want Australia’s vast natural resources to sustain their own growing populations. The transmission also reveals that Cobbler’s Bay is one of only three main ports being used by the invaders.

What is tomorrow when the war began about?

Tomorrow, When the War Began. Tomorrow, When the War Began, published in 1993, is the first book in the Tomorrow Series by John Marsden. It is a young adult invasion novel, detailing a high-intensity invasion and occupation of Australia by a foreign power.

Who played Ellie in Tomorrow when the war began?

Tomorrow, When the War Began was adapted into a feature film of the same name that was released on 2 September 2010 in Australia and New Zealand. It was written and directed by Stuart Beattie, and starred Caitlin Stasey in the role of Ellie Linton. 8 wins & 14 nominations.
